* { margin: 0; padding: 0; }
body { margin: 0; padding: 0; background: #fff; }

a, a:link, a:visited { color: #ff0000; }
a:hover, a:active { color: #000 }

span { display: none; }

div.outer {
width: 520px;
height: 300px;
margin: 50px auto 50px auto;
background: #fff url('../images/logo.gif') no-repeat top center;
text-align: center;
padding-top: 65px;
font: 13px/18px Verdana, Arial, Sans-Serif; 
}

.mainimg {
border: 1px solid #999;
padding: 3px;
}
